The cheapest way to get from Spain to Agrigento is to fly and train which costs €40 - €190 and takes 7h 55m.
The fastest way to get from Spain to Agrigento is to fly and train which takes 7h 34m and costs €70 - €220.
No, there is no direct bus from Spain station to Agrigento. However, there are services departing from Barcelona - North Bus Station and arriving at Agrigento Piazzale Vittorio Emanuele via Roma, Autostazione Tiburtina.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 33h 45m.
The distance between Spain and Agrigento is 1190 km.
The best way to get from Spain to Agrigento without a car is to bus which takes 33h 45m and costs €110 - €220.
It takes approximately 7h 55m to get from Spain to Agrigento, including transfers.
